What is the procedure to restore a registered file sync server: Azure File sync on BMR

I had to bare metal restore a file sync server without the data disk on lets say d:\ drive.Now after, I think file sync agent automatically, recreated the folders on d:\ all seems healthy in file sync,

But the files are not downloaded from azure to the server. Is there a how to procedure out there, what to do, if a registered server needs to be bare metal restored?

    Azure File Sync doesn’t support BMR because the registry maintains configuration information that can get out of sync with the Azure File Sync service when performing a BMR.
    If you notice that creating, deleting, or updating server endpoints on the server is failing.

    Recommended steps if the system and data volumes are lost.

    Option #1:

    1. • Perform a clean install of Windows Server
    2. • Install the Azure File Sync agent
    3. • Register the server
    4. • Re-add the server endpoint in the existing sync group
    5. • Sync will download the data to the new server
    6. List item Option #2:
    7. • Perform a clean install of Windows Server
    8. • Install the Azure File Sync agent
    9. • Register the server
    10. • Restore the data volume from backup
    11. • Re-add the server endpoint in the existing sync group
    12. • Sync will reconcile the data on the server and Azure file share
